because the canvas text drawing impl falls back to using an OutputDevice view
of the canvas to use the vcl text drawing apis to achieve vertical text
To get an OutputDevice view of the canvas there is a specific VirtualDevice
ctor available to create a VirtualDevice that, unlike the normal case, doesn't
have its own specific backing buffer, but instead draws to the underlying target
provided via the SystemGraphicsData arg
The svp/gtk impl missed that understanding and provided an ordinary
VirtualDevice with its own backing buffer, not a VirtualDevice that would draw
to the expected target surface of the canvas. So the vertical text was drawn to
a different surface than the intended one, and was just discarded.
The cairo use in the canvas long precedes the use of cairo in vcl itself.
Seeing as text is now rendered with cairo in all cases where the canvas uses
cairo its probably now pointless for canvas to have its own text rendering
path.

if they are different from the "normal" page counts.
If the document contains automatically inserted blank
pages, and the document setting "Print automatically
inserted blank pages" is disabled, the status bar still
shows page counts with blank pages. This is a problem
especially, if the user wants to print a document range,
because it's not possible to read the correct printing
range from the status bar, and using the showed values,
printing can result unwanted and missing printed pages
without any notice if the Preview option is disabled
in the Print dialog window (otherwise if the differency
was noticed, it could be hard or near impossible to
correct the range using the Preview window).
Now, for example, if the title page followed an
automatically inserted blank page and a third page,
the status bar shows the following on the third
page, if there is a differency in printing:
Page 3 of 3 (Page 2 of 2 to print)
If the setting "Print automatically inserted blank
pages" of the actual document is enabled on page
"LibreOffice Writer" of the File->Print... dialog
window, or the document doesn't contain automatically
inserted blank pages, there is no information
about printed pages in the status bar (because there
is no differency in page counting):
Page 3 of 3

This reverts commit d35840a2111beafe018851314a624e268e3cde6a, now that
43aef04d77aafb9d055957642e62b559231f3711 "Reliably wait for soffice to
terminate" makes sure that no soffice-related processes are left behind by
UITests. Using PR_SET_PDEATHSIG had the following drawbacks:
* It defeats debugging if a runaway process is forcefully killed by the test
framework. (And there are already higher-layer mechanisms in place for the
reliable termination of runaway tinderbox builds, see the commit message of
43aef04d77aafb9d055957642e62b559231f3711 mentioned above.)
* It is brittle in that it can terminate soffice-related processes too early, as
the signal is sent as soon as the parent's thread that spawned the child (and
not the parent process as a whole) terminates.
* It is Linux-only.
